
Chaotic scenes at ‘Die Hok’ must never be repeated
[Herald Live - South Africa] - 15/07/2025
No stone must be left unturned when EP rugby bosses gather on Tuesday for a disciplinary inquiry into a crowd invasion which resulted in a match between Gardens and Progress being abandoned in June.
